Under the direction of Elenoa Tuitavuki Pua, Kanani Pua originated in 2014 in West Jordan, Utah.  Elenoa was born and raised in the islands of O’ahu, Hawaii and has performed at the Polynesian Cultural Center since she was of high school age. Upon moving to Utah, Kanani Pua has grown into a dance company that captures the authenticity of Polynesia. Kanani Pua has been invited to perform at many annual festivals and events, and with the expertise of Pasimata Larsen & Tony Paialii as well as authentic musicians, Kanani Pua cultivates Polynesian culture through dance and music.
